Property Details for 3/5 Gladstone St, Battery Point

3/5 Gladstone St, Battery Point is a 2 bedroom, 2 bathroom Unit with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1994. The property has a land size of 277m2 and floor size of 126m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in June 2023.

Last Listing description (August 2023)

Located in the exclusive Salamanca Mews, this classic two bedroom, two bathroom ground floor apartment at the city end of Battery Point is in an ideal position: it is close to Hobart's CBD, Salamanca Place, and the buzz of the Hobart waterfront, whilst having the peace and beauty of historic St David's Park on its boundary. Designed with the environment in mind are three separate low level buildings in the complex comprising three levels of apartments plus a penthouse level. Attractive, established gardens are a feature of the complex, offering privacy and giving a sense of wellbeing in this historic, city fringe environment.

Number 3 is located on the western side of the building enjoying afternoon sun in both bedrooms, the spacious living area and their surrounding private courtyard. Once inside the grounds of the Mews, gradual steps lead to the secure front door of the building and into the wide foyer, which is also accessed by a lift and stairwell from the basement carpark where there are two allocated carspaces. On entering the apartment a generous entry and hallway give access to all the rooms. The light-filled, spacious living/dining room has windows curving around its outer walls with sliding doors opening onto the extensive courtyard. Being a ground floor apartment, this area is surrounded by greenery maintained by the body corporate, is securely fenced, has an under-cover section, and is ideal for alfresco living. The kitchen has ample storage with two walk-in cupboards at either end, and while separate from the living/dining room, opens onto it, allowing easy interaction between the two areas. The two double bedrooms are found along the hallway, each with built-in robes, the spacious primary bedroom with en suite. A separate bathroom and laundry are also accessed from the hallway.

Built in 1994, the Salamanca Mews complex offers secure, spacious apartment living within a short walk of all that Salamanca Place and the Hobart waterfront have to offer: cafes, restaurants, shops and galleries, along with the working ferries, fishing boats and punts, and the scientific pursuits of IMAS and the CSIRO . A little further afield, but still within walking distance is the Tasmanian Museum and Art Gallery, the Iconic Theatre Royal and the CBD of Hobart. This is a prime property in a most selective and tightly held complex.

About Battery Point 7004

The size of Battery Point is approximately 0.7 square kilometres. It has 6 parks covering nearly 5.5% of total area. The population of Battery Point in 2016 was 1997 people. By 2021 the population was 2096 showing a population growth of 5.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Battery Point is 20-29 years. Households in Battery Point are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Battery Point work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 50.30% of the homes in Battery Point were owner-occupied compared with 51.20% in 2016.

Battery Point has 1,746 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Battery Point have seen a 21.77%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 21.23%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Battery Point is $1,474,748 while the median value for Units is $880,745.
  • Houses have a median rent of $698 while Units have a median rent of $600.
